Benzocaína sobre respostas ao estresse do matrinxã submetido ao transporte em sacos plásticos Benzocaine on the stress response of matrinxã subjected to transport in plastic bags

Authors: Araceli Hackbarth; Luís Antônio Kioshi Aoki Inoue; Gilberto Moraes;

Benzocaína sobre respostas ao estresse do matrinxã submetido ao transporte em sacos plásticos Benzocaine on the stress response of matrinxã subjected to transport in plastic bags

Abstract

O transporte é uma prática de manejo necessária em todas as estações de piscicultura. Entretanto, tal evento é um estímulo adverso e agudo, que interrompe o equilíbrio dos animais com o ambiente, de forma a promover o estresse. Alguns peixes de importância comercial, como o matrinxã (Brycon amazonicus), apresentam movimentação excessiva durante o manejo em geral, o que pode ocasionar consequências indesejáveis como perda de muco, de escamas, ferimentos e mortalidade. No presente trabalho, foi testado o anestésico benzocaína adicionado à água de transporte, como forma de reduzir estresse. Foram testadas duas concentrações de benzocaína, 10 e 15mg/L. Os resultados não mostraram efeitos de diminuição de estresse, apesar de a utilização da benzocaína ter reduzido a movimentação dos animais durante o transporte. As concentrações testadas podem ter aumentado o estresse por sofrimento respiratório, entretanto, o equilíbrio hidroeletrolítico não foi alterado, com sugestão de ação do anestésico sobre a liberação de catecolaminas.Transport is a necessary procedure in fish farming. However, it is an adverse and acute stimulus that breaks the balance between fish and environment, starting the stress condition. Some economic relevant species, as “matrinxã” (Brycon amazonicus), present excessive movements in handling, which may result in the unwanted consequences as loss of mucus, scales, injuries and death. In this work, the addition of the anesthetic benzocaine to the transport water was evaluated in juvenile “matrinxã”, in order to still the fish and possibly reducing stress. Two concentrations of benzocaine (10 and 15mg/L) were tested. The results did not show any diminution of indices related to stress, notwithstanding the use of benzocaine during transport. Concentrations tested increased the stress responses by respiratory affliction, however, hydro-electrolytic balance was unaltered, being suggested some effect of the anesthetic on the catecholamine releasing.
